Version One and PS Financials provide document management in the finance function

29th January 2007

PS Financials the provider of accounting software and Version One the document management and imaging specialist have signed an agreement that will see the complete integration of Version One's 'paperless office' technology into PS Financials' accounting and business management software. The announcement follows a string of similar deals by Version One which now integrates with every popular ERP system.

The latest deal means that users of PS Financials will be able to access directly electronically archived documents, such as supplier invoices and automatically deliver, authorise and manage from within their accounting software.

Richard Pierce, PS Financials' MD says, "Our partnership with Version One, which is in response to increasing worldwide demand for integrated paperless office technologies, will ensure PS Financials' users have access to the most advanced document management functionality on the market."

"Our users will be able to improve business efficiency whilst making dramatic savings of time, money and storage space."

Tony Bray, Director of Version One says, "Manual, paper-based processes do not make good business sense; they are time-consuming, costly, inefficient and prone to error. This strategic partnership will give PS Financials' users direct access to Version One's software, enabling them to further streamline their business processes."
